To create a collection letter for overdue accounts, start by addressing the letter to the debtor in a professional manner. Clearly state the outstanding amount, the due date, and any relevant invoice numbers. Include a polite but firm request for payment and mention the consequences of continued non-payment. Utilizing a sample collection letter for overdue accounts can guide you through the necessary structure and language, ensuring your message is effective and respectful.

Letters written to customers with overdue accounts typically include reminder letters, final notices, and collection letters. Each letter serves a different purpose, escalating the urgency as needed. Reviewing a sample collection letter for overdue accounts can help you determine the appropriate language and tone for each situation.
